> I get regularly the following type of "out of office..."
>  most of the time I couldn't care less, but what is
>  this and why do we get them?

This is an example of a brain dead company buying brain dead software.
There is an awful lot of this going around.

The theory is nice, that there is no such thing as mailing lists & news 
groups & newsletters, the only thing that e-mail is used for is from one 
person to another person & the software is setup using that theory, which as 
we all know is a seriously flawed theory.

If the theory was valid, that the only e-mail we get is from other people 
associated with our business, then it is important to tell them that we out 
of office & that if you need immediate personnel dealing with your business 
contact here is who to contact instead, so the software is setup with the 
assumption that that is the only kind of e-mail you getting.

Thus ever person who posts anything to MIDRANGE_L or any other lists that 
have these people on them, will get one of these things, or in some cases, 
when I make a post to BPCS_L or E-COMMERCE or E-SECURITY or whatever list, I 
get half a dozen of these things, from diifferent participants on the list 
who have setup their software to auto reply to the original poster.

For a long time I railed against this - we need better software.
Then I read a review of this software in major PC magazines.
Apparently the software does recognize mailing lists & news groups & 
e-newsletters & etc, & has filters so you not telling spammers this 
information about you being a good e-mail address for more spam, which I am 
sure would give these people heart attacks if they realized they were doing 
that.
The problem is the competence of the people who install the software.
